DIRECT HIRE: The Senior Commissioning Superintendent is a senior field leader responsible for driving the full-lifecycle commissioning execution of mechanical, electrical, and controls systems on hyperscale data center projects (100MW+). With deep expertise in mission-critical mechanical infrastructure - including chillers, dry coolers, fan coil units, pumps, and HVAC systems - this role owns the field commissioning program from pre-functional testing through Integrated Systems Testing (IST) and owner acceptance. Operating with the authority and credibility of an experienced owner's-side professional, the Sr. Superintendent serves as the on-site commissioning leader, aligning trade contractors, commissioning agents, engineers, and client representatives around a single, accountable execution plan. This role is critical to delivering fully operational, high-availability facilities on schedule and to the highest quality standard.

Required Experience/Qualifications:
  • 7–10 years of progressive field commissioning and supervision experience, with a demonstrated focus on hyperscale mission-critical data center infrastructure (100MW+)
  • Current or recent Superintendent title with proven ownership of large-scale commissioning programs from mobilization through owner acceptance
  • Deep mechanical expertise in the commissioning of chillers, dry coolers, fan coil units, pumps, cooling towers, and HVAC systems in redundant, live-environment data center facilities
  • Hands-on working knowledge of electrical and controls systems — including switchgear, UPS, generators, BMS, and EPMS — sufficient to lead integrated MEP commissioning activities and cross-discipline coordination
  • Prior experience on the owner's rep or client side, providing a distinct ability to anticipate owner expectations, interpret acceptance criteria, and align field execution with client priorities
  • Proven track record leading pre-functional testing, functional performance testing, and Integrated Systems Testing (IST) on complex, high-availability facilities
  • Demonstrated ability to lead high-stakes client and stakeholder meetings, present commissioning status and risk with confidence, and drive accountability across all project participants
  • Expert command of six-week look-ahead scheduling, constraint management, and visual planning tools including takt boards and zone maps
  • In-depth knowledge of MEP construction methods, commissioning specifications, and data center delivery standards applied to large-scale, live-environment projects
  • Strong proficiency in scheduling software and the ability to apply logic-driven planning to complex, multi-discipline commissioning sequences
  • Thorough understanding of electrical safety, OSHA regulations, and energized work procedures in mission-critical environments
  • Proven conflict-resolution, problem-solving, and professional judgment skills in fast-paced, high-consequence project environments
  • Proficient in Microsoft Office Suite and project management/operational platforms
